There was a single screening in Tokyo last December on the anniversary
of Ozu's birth. It opens in Taiwan at the end of the year, with the
"domestic" premiere at the Kaohsiung Film Festival later this month.
It just competed in Venice.
Venice jury member Hsu Feng is interviewed in today's Taiwan press.
Despite her support, neither of the Chinese films - by Hou and Jia
Zhangke - got through to the second round of voting. She urges Chinese
filmmakers to be more considerate of the audience.
